One Piece Film Z (2012) One Piece Film Z is the 12th feature film in the One Piece franchise, released on . Directed by Tatsuya Nagamine and scripted by Osamu Suzuki , it was the first film in the series set after the "time-skip," featuring the Straw Hat Pirates in their New World designs. Original creator Eiichiro Oda served as the general producer, ensuring character consistency and overseeing major creative decisions. Plot Summary
